EXCLUSIVE: Studio 8 just brought in another project. The company has acquired the action/thriller _Champion_ about two American brothers, wrongly sentenced to prison in Thailand, who are


then forced to compete in Thai boxing for a chance to win their freedom. The company is now out to directors. This comes after Studio 8 recently acquired Graham Moore’s female strong, sci-fi


thriller _Naked is the Best Disguise_, another sci-fi thriller from Robert Rodriguez and Max Borenstein’s entitled _Hypnotic_ and the action thriller pitch _Planet Kill_ which will be


produced by Steven Soderbergh who may direct. _Naked is the Best Disguise_ has been fast-tracked to go before the cameras this year. The screenplay for _Champion_ was rewritten by Brad


Ingelsby (_Run All Night, Out of the Furnace_) from an original spec screenplay by Gary Scott Thompson (_Fast and the Furious_). The project was originally developed at Storyscape


Entertainment with Bob Cooper and Richard Saperstein who will both produce along with Pioneer Pictures’ Robert Kravis and Karl Hermann. Tyler Mitchell and Marc Fiorentino are on as executive
